What is Specialty Floater?
A specialty floater would be a team player willing to work with all departments. The departments would include Surgery, Neurology, Internal medicine, Cardiology, Medical Oncology and Radiation Oncology. A floater would work with the teams and be part of the team they are working with. You will assist both the Doctors and support staff in their day to day functions. You would be training in all aspects of each service.
What does the Specialty Floater do?
The Specialty Floater technician/assistant assists our board-certified Doctors with all aspects of day to day function. It would including seeing routine and sick appointments, performing diagnostics, completing blood work for patients, accurate and precise venipuncture skills, patient examination and restraint, administering and monitoring anesthesia in the pre-, peri-, and post-operative periods, discharging patients from the hospital, and client communications.
